Description
The MAX2430 is a versatile, silicon RF power amplifier that operates directly from a 3V to 5.5V supply, making it suitable for 3-cell Ni Cd or 1-cell lithium-ion battery applications. It is designed for use in the 800MHz to 1000MHz frequency range and, at 915MHz, can produce +21d Bm (125m W) of output power with greater than 32d B of gain at VCC = 3.6V. A unique shutdown function provides an off supply current of typically less than 1µA to save power during “idle slots” in time-division multiple-access (TDMA) transmissions. An external capacitor sets the RF output power envelope ramp time. External power control is also possible over a 15d B range. The amplifier’s input is matched on-chip to 50Ω. The output is an open collector that is easily matched to a 50Ω load with few external ponents.
